Quillpress only rebuilds pages whose content actually changed, which is why local setup needs the build-state database running. First, install deps with `qp install`, then start the watcher via `qp dev --incremental`. The watcher hashes each content file and compares against stored fingerprints — no fingerprint store, no incremental magic, just painfully full rebuilds. Don't delete the `rebuild_state` table unless you enjoy ten-minute builds. Point your local watcher at the fingerprint database using the connection string below.

primary connection of yagep-kahip = redis://giliel_svc:zYiKsLL2PLpfPL@db-348f.xolmarsys.corp:5432/fenwyn

- [ ] Step 7: Archive cold storage buckets (Glacierline tier). Confirm both ceremony witnesses are present, verify bucket manifests match the Oxbow ledger, then seal the archive key shares. Plugin authors may observe but not handle shares. Once sealed, the archive index itself is encrypted and can only be reopened with the passphrase below.

vault phrase of badup-hahig = tamael-aldael-kelmir-istael-fenok-istwyn-tamius-jorath-oliion

Service account: report-export-tz. The Ledgerline export worker converts all report timestamps from UTC to each customer's configured timezone before rendering. It runs under the report-export-tz account, which has read access to the timezone registry and write access to the export bucket. If exports show UTC times, the account has likely lost registry access. The account authenticates to the internal TimeVault registry with the key shown below.

gateway credential: kto3_qfe

Leadership Review Briefing: Meridel Plus Tier

Meridel Plus launches next quarter at a mid-range price point between Basic and Pro. It adds priority support and offline access. Branch managers should expect migration questions from existing Pro customers; retention scripts arrive next week. Early trials in the Varrow region showed 12% uptake. The tier's role in our broader commercial plan follows below.

board note of tadup-tajog: Headcount on the Oliiel team goes from 31 to 88 by the end of February. Gross margin on Oliiel came in at 62 percent against a plan of 29 percent.